AMENORRHOEA
• Amenorrhea is classified as either primary or secondary.
• Primary amenorrhea is the lack of menstruation by the
age of 16yrs in the presence of normal development of
secondary sexual characters.
• Secondary amenorrhea is the absence of menstruation
for 6 consecutive months after menarche or in a woman
who has had a normal menstrual cycle.
• In a woman of childbearing age, the most common causes
of absent menstrual periods are pregnancy and lactation
Etiology
• There are three general causes of secondary
amenorrhea:
• Hormonal disturbance leading to a lack of a
normal menstrual cycle,
• Physical damage to the endometrium which
prevents its growth, or
• Obstruction of the outflow path of the
menstrual blood.
Pathophysiology
• Many potential causes of secondary amenorrhea.
• Hormonal causes include pregnancy, lactation, thyroid
dysfunction, hyperprolactinemia, hyperandrogenism
(including polycystic ovarian syndrome), hypogonadotropic
hypogonadism (hypothalamic-pituitary dysfunction), and
suppression of the endometrium by hormonal birth control.
• Structural causes include damage to the endometrium
(Asherman’s syndrome) and obstruction of the outflow tract
(cervical stenosis).
• Epidemiology
• Pregnancy, lactation,
and menopause are
common, physiologic
causes of secondary
amenorrhea.
• Prevalence of secondary
amenorrhea due to all
other causes is
approximately 2% - 5%
Spontaneous, cyclic menstruation requires an intact and
functional hypothalamic-pituitary ovarian axis
(HPOA),endometrium and genital outflow tract.
Abnormalities in any of these structures may result in
amenorrhea

1.Hypothalamus
• Changes in GnRH signaling from the
hypothalamus to the pituitary can
disrupt this communication and
cause low gonadotropin (LH and FSH)
secretion and secondary amenorrhea
• Isolated deficit of gonadotropins
represent a rare cause of
hypothalamic amenorrhea, including
the Kallman syndrome and the
idiopathic hypogonadotropic
hypogonadism
• A common condition that results from disruption in this
process is functional hypothalamic amenorrhea (FHA),
which accounts for approximately 35% of all pathologic
secondary amenorrhea
• FHA is caused by stress from events such as severe
restrictive dieting, poor nutritional status, extreme
psychological stress, or excessive exercise.
• Recently genetic mutations have been associated with
FHA
• Less commonly, infiltrative diseases of hypothalamus
such as lymphoma, sarcoidosis or Langerhans cell
histiocytosis can interfere with hypothalamic function
PITUITARY GLAND
• The pituitary gland responds to GnRH signaling to
produce LH and FSH (also in a pulsatile fashion)
• Any change in the secretion of pituitary hormones can
lead to sec amen eg hyperprolactinaemia
• even a small change in prolactin may be sufficient to
change the menstrual pattern.
• Elevated prolactin levels should also prompt a check of
thyroid function because hypothyroidism can cause
hyperprolactinemia
PITUITARY GLAND
• An intact stalk is necessary for transmitting inhibitory signals to
the prolactin-secreting cells to prevent secretion. When normal
“tonic” inhibition is lifted by stalk compression, the pituitary
gland produces more prolactin. A common cause of stalk
compression is a pituitary adenoma.
• Any structural lesion in or near the pituitary gland can cause a
modest elevation in prolactin. When prolactin levels are
elevated (2 to 10 times normal), this usually indicates a
prolactin-lactotroph-secreting pituitary adenoma
PITUITARY GLAND
• Amenorrhea occurs when the process disrupts pituitary
function and results in decreased gonadotropin secretion
• Pituitary infarction can cause amenorrhea and sheehan
syndrome is a result of pituitary infarction following
postpartum hemorrhage or severe hypotension
• Results in partial or total loss of hormone secretion
• Can cause various endocrine deficiencies, such as
hypogonadotropic hypogonadism (loss of lh and fsh
secretion);secondary hypothyroidism (loss of thyroid-
stimulating hormone [tsh] secretion); and secondary
adrenal insufficiency (loss of adrenocorticotropic
hormone secretion).
3 OVARIES
• PCOS is the most common endocrine disorder in women of
reproductive age, occurring in 7% to 10% of all young
women.
• It is characterised by altered FSH:LH ratio
• Hyperandrogenism
• Increased insulin resistance
• increased risk for prediabetes, type 2 diabetes mellitus
(T2DM), metabolic syndrome, fatty liver disease, and
obstructive sleep apnea
OVARIES
• When menopause or spontaneous loss of ovarian function
occurs prior to age 40, it is called spontaneous primary ovarian
insufficiency (POI), formerly referred to as premature ovarian
failure.
• Spontaneous POI is characterized by permanent cessation of
ovulation and menstruation. It can be idiopathic, a result of
prior surgery or chemotherapy, or a result of an autoimmune
process.
• FSHwill be elevated (greater than 30 to 40 IU/L) with low
estradiol levels (usually below 30 pg/mL)
• rare causes-Turner syndrome (lack of a second X chromosome),
fragile X syndrome, radiation to the pelvis, and a history of
mumps or cytomegalovirus.
4. Uterus
• A less common cause of amenorrhea is Asherman
syndrome, which is fibrosis of the endometrium and
resulting lack of regeneration that leads to amenorrhea.
This can occur after instrumentation of the uterine cavity,
such as uterine curettage, myomectomy, cervical biopsy, or
polypectomy or insertion of an intrauterine device (IUD).
• More recently, therapeutic endometrial ablation has been
known to cause sec amen
Uterus
Women with
endometrial
tuberculosis can
develop secendory
amenorrhoea
5. OTHER CAUSES
• Adrenal factors:Adrenal tumor or hyperplasia
• Cushing’s syndrome
• Thyroid factors : Hypothyroid state
• General disease :Malnutrition,tuberculosis,chronic
nephritis,diabetes etc.
• Iatrogenic : Contraceptive pills (Postpill
amenorrhoea)..Suppression of Gnrh release
• Psychotrophic drugs : phenothiazine derivatives…Dopamine
receptor blocking agents raise the prolactin level
• Antihypertensive drugs : reserpine or dopamine antagonists
: Dopamine depleting agents raise the prolactin level
WORK UP FOR A CASE OF SECONDARY
AMENORRHEA
HISTORY
Menstrual Cycle – Age of Menarche & Previous Menstrual History
Previous Pregnancies – Severe PPH( Sheehan’s Syndrome )
Weight Change – Excessive Weight Loss
Hot Flushes, Decreased Libido – Premature Menopause
Certain Medications
Contraception
Associated Symptoms – Cushing’s Disease, Hypothyroidism
Previous Gynaecological Surgery
Chronic illness
HISTORY. . .
• Review the menstrual intervals since menarche, and note
when any changes may have occurred along with any
other changes in medical history, social history,
medications, or weight that may have coincided with a
change in the menstrual pattern.
• Some women may consider “spotting” to be a normal
menstrual cycle, so ascertaining typical menstrual flow is
also important.
• Pregnancy and lactation
HISTORY
• Social and weight history
• any behaviors consistent with eating disorders or
excessive focus on weight and exercise. This would
include history of severe caloric restriction, laxative or
diuretic use, extreme and prolonged exercise regimens,
or evidence of obsession with weight/exercise
• Psychological stressors may include domestic violence
and/or a history of sexual or psychological trauma.
Health stressors could include severe or life-threatening
illness or injuries, noting the relationship of these events
to any change in the menstrual cycle or amenorrhea.
EXAMINATION
 GENERAL EXAMINATION
•Nutritional Status
•Extreme Emaciation Or Marked Obesity
•Presence Of Acne Or Hirsutism
•Discharge Of Milk From Breasts
ABDOMINAL EXAMINATION
• Presence Of Striae Associated With Obesity May be related to
Cushing’s Disease
• A Mass In The Lower Abdomen.
PELVIC EXAMINATION
• Enlargement of Clitoris
• Adnexal Mass Suggestive Of Tubercular tubo-ovarian mass or
ovarian tumor
PELVIC ULTRASOUND
• endometrial lining,
• including thickening of the lining
(indicating lack of adequate
endometrial shedding)
• or absence of lining, as seen in
FHA or Asherman syndrome.
• diagnosis of PCOS,
DIAGNOSTIC APPROACH
• It is important to correlate hyperandrogenism with the
physical exam. If the patient has significant hirsutism,
persistent adult acne, or male pattern scalp hair loss, there
is strong positive evidence for clinical hyperandrogenism
and supports suspicion for PCOS or other androgen excess
disorders
Treatment / Management
Treatment depends on the underlying cause of the
amenorrhea
• Polycystic ovarian syndrome is treated with weight loss
• Metformin for insulin resistance, and
• Cycle control with combined oral contraceptives or endometrial protection with
progestin-containing birth control methods (medroxyprogesterone acetate depot
injection, etonogestrel subcutaneous implant, or levonorgestrel intrauterine
system).
• Hypothyroidism is treated with thyroxine replacement.
• Hyperthyroidism is treated with thioamides, ablation, or surgery.
• Hyperprolactinemia is treated with bromocriptine, cabergoline, or excision of
prolactinoma.
• Ovarian failure may be treated with hormone replacement, depending on the
patient’s age, symptoms, and other risk factors.
• Hypothalamic-pituitary dysfunction may be treated with lifestyle changes or with
hormone replacement.
• Asherman’s syndrome is treated with hysteroscopic lysis of adhesions.
• Cervical stenosis is treated with cervical dilation.
